Ecommerce website development involves the creation, enhancement, and maintenance of online stores that facilitate the buying and selling of goods and services over the internet. From user interface design to backend infrastructure, every aspect of development plays a pivotal role in shaping the user experience and overall success of an ecommerce venture.

 

Key Considerations for Ecommerce Success

 

1. Platform Selection:

Choosing the right ecommerce platform sets the foundation for your online store. Popular options like Shopify, WooCommerce, Magento, and BigCommerce offer varying levels of flexibility, scalability, and customization.

 

2. User Experience (UX) Design:

UX design focuses on creating a seamless and intuitive shopping experience. This includes easy navigation, mobile responsiveness, fast loading times, and a secure checkout process to minimize cart abandonment.

 

3. Responsive Web Design:

With a significant portion of online traffic coming from mobile devices, responsive design is non-negotiable. Your ecommerce site must adapt seamlessly to different screen sizes and resolutions.

 

4. Product Catalog and Inventory Management:

Efficient catalog management ensures that your products are accurately displayed with detailed descriptions, high-quality images, and real-time inventory updates to prevent overselling.

 

5. Payment Gateway Integration:

Secure payment processing is paramount. Integrate trusted payment gateways that support multiple currencies and payment methods to accommodate global customers.

 

6. Security and Compliance:

Implement robust security measures, such as SSL certificates and PCI DSS compliance, to protect customer data and build trust.

 

7. SEO and Digital Marketing:

Optimize your ecommerce site for search engines to attract organic traffic. Implement digital marketing strategies, including content marketing, social media marketing, and email campaigns, to drive sales and customer engagement.

 

8. Analytics and Performance Tracking:

Utilize analytics tools to monitor site performance, track key metrics (e.g., conversion rates, bounce rates), and gain actionable insights for continuous improvement.
